NOTE: In Windows Vista, you need to close the “Bi-directional” function for
better compatibility with some printers. On the desktop, go to Start and Settings,
then select “Printers.” On the Printers screen, right-click the printer and select
“Properties.” On the Properties screen, disable the bi-directional support.
7. raW Printing
RAW printing allows users to connect to printers via TCP/IP for print sharing. A
computer with a Windows 2000/XP/Server 2003 operating system can use the
protocol to share printing on the network. The MFP server can support RAW
printing by default.
To congure the RAW setting in Windows 2000/XP/Server 2003, follow the steps
below. Note that the following procedures and screen samples are representative
of Windows XP. For Windows 2000/Server 2003, the procedures are similar.
1. On the desktop, go to Start, then Settings. Select “Printers and Faxes.”
2. Click “Add a Printer.”
